A deep‑flavored, oven‑braised chili con carne that extracts maximum taste from toasted ancho chilies and beef chuck. The chilies are toasted, re‑hydrated in their own flavorful broth, then turned into a paste that coats the meat. Slow cooking at 150 °C yields fork‑tender beef with a rich, smoky heat. Optional resting overnight mellows the spice and brightens the broth.
